FinallyFree's Post:
”Cash book sales vs. account debit book sales were a point of high contention at LAD. Whenever GI (Gross Income) was low the ED/CO would check the book sales and ask for the dollar amount that was debited from accounts. One ED and another CO in particular focused in on reducing account debiting for book sales.
Book sales done from debiting from partial or fully paid serviced of any kind was heavily frowned upon. I personally observed the CO accuse the FBO of deliberately attempting to sabotage the org from large debits done off accounts. Debits from service payments. It was a bizarre scene the FBO was constantly with the BSO on book sales. (My memory is foggy on this one. Maybe I didn’t notice the out-point until I now because I am out – but is the FBO senior to the BSO in any way? Why would the FBO product officer the BSO? Carmel – do you know?) Anyways. It was like a witch hunt. WHO is selling books by debiting accounts? WHY aren’t they getting CASH for books??? THEY’RE SUPRESSIVE! It was even subject to an announcement by the CO that staff pay was going to be horrible because of large debits for book sales.
Well then Bridge starting coming into our org…. because someone was suppressing book sales. So then we had Bridge SO members and the FBO in a power struggle with the CO. So then the CO went to management….. Being on staff is hard enough. Try being on staff where any ASHO, AO, Bridge, FOLO, CLO S.O. member could walk right into your org at any time for any reason. Shit I have seen DM, WDC’s and Leserve and cronies with my on eyeballs in my org. Cross ordering, being screamed at for not answering a telex or meeting quotas….. yeah it was all fun and games at LA Day. OH and being subjected to the same S.O. all-hands – because your org sat next to S.O. orgs…. How many times have I said “But I am not S.O.!”……”
